Glassdoor users rated their interview experience at Siemens Energy as 80% positive with a difficulty rating score of 2.4 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ty). Candidates interviewing for Project Manager and Senior Engineer rated their interviews as the hardest, whereas interviews for Student Worker and Senior Data Scientist roles were rated as the easiest.
The hiring process at Siemens Energy takes an average of 21 days when considering 5 user submitted interviews across all job titles. Candidates applying for Wind Energy Loads Engineer had the quickest hiring process (on average 7 days), whereas Student Worker roles had the slowest hiring process (on average 35 days).

First was a typical screening interview. Mine was recorded answers since it was during Covid.
Second was a more technical interview, with problem solving and showing skills.
Third was with Managers
Three rounds of interviews, standard interview questions. First interview was with local HR and hiring team member. Second interview was just with international HR Director. Third interview was with the manager. Had to chase the outcome.

After three interviews and a project which I had to develop I was ghosted by Siemens Energy. No feedback, no anything.
Not to mention that although the project was promoted as being remote it turned out that it actually required being in the office.
Furthermore, though it was a digital role, it also involved taking part and being involved in live events.
